package godot
import (
"github.com/shadowapex/godot-go/gdnative"
)
/*------------------------------------------------------------------------------
// This code was generated by a tool.
//
// Changes to this file may cause incorrect behavior and will be lost if
// the code is regenerated. Any updates should be done in
// "class.go.tmpl" so they can be included in the generated
// code.
//----------------------------------------------------------------------------*/
//func NewSprite3DFromPointer(ptr gdnative.Pointer) Sprite3D {
func newSprite3DFromPointer(ptr gdnative.Pointer) Sprite3D {
owner := gdnative.NewObjectFromPointer(ptr)
obj := Sprite3D{}
obj.SetBaseObject(owner)
return obj
}
/*
A node that displays a 2D texture in a 3D environment. The texture displayed can be a region from a larger atlas texture, or a frame from a sprite sheet animation.
*/
type Sprite3D struct {
SpriteBase3D
owner gdnative.Object
}
func (o *Sprite3D) BaseClass() string {
return "Sprite3D"
}
